WebThe court, however, is required to consider whether the failure to pay rent was willful, caused by exigent circumstances unlikely to recur, the tenant’s ability to pay the judgment, the … WebOct 15, 2024 · A tenancy that approaches constructive eviction carries considerable risk for a landlord, too. Deferring maintenance on commercial rental space could lead to losing commercial tenants, who typically commit to long-term, multi-year leases. Tenants who can establish constructive eviction are free of these long-term obligations.
